Short on time but want to see Canada? Take our one-way trip from Vancouver to Banff for a quick tour into the Rocky Mountains. The 2-day Roadrunner tour takes you through the Coast Mountains, with a stop in Kelowna. Along the way, you’ll experience the scenic drive through the beautiful British Columbia landscape, before crossing into Alberta and finishing in the heart of the Canadian Rockies – Banff!
Note: The Roadrunner is the first 2 days of the 8-day Caribou tour. Some of your fellow travellers will be returning to Vancouver once your part of the journey ends.
At our first stop, we’ll take a short walk in a west coast rainforest to check out Bridal Veil Falls.
We'll stop to pickup lunch supplies in the self-proclaimed "Chainsaw Carving Capital of Canada", the town of Hope, BC.
Have an indigenous lunch at Kekuli Cafe
See this historic site where the last railroad spike on the Canadian Pacific Railway was driven in November 1885, connecting Canada from West to East.
We will spend the night in the picturesque mountain town of Revelstoke
In Revelstoke, you'll have the option to go kayaking on a lake, in beautiful, hand crafted wooden kayaks, surrounded by beautiful mountain scenery!
Walk on some of Canadas tallest suspension bridges for epic views.
Continuing onwards, we’ll finally enter the Rocky Mountains and cross over the Kicking Horse Pass into Alberta and Banff National Park. Tonight, our tour finishes in the historic town of Banff, in the heart of the mountains.
